Mohamed Ramadan Says 'Upcoming Series to Feature Character with Abu Obaida's Name'

Egyptian Star Mohamed Ramadan responded to the criticism directed at him by the Israeli Channel 10, which called on the Israeli people to boycott his works, against the backdrop of a message he sent to the Arab armies regarding Gaza.

Ramadan said in a video he posted on his social media accounts: “The Israeli Channel 10 calls on the Israeli people to boycott my work because I made a video urging Arabs to unite and defend our sisters, women, and blood in Gaza.”

The Egyptian artist added in a response to the Israeli channel: “This is the least duty I do in front of my sisters, and the second duty I do for you, and this is my message to the Israeli Channel 10, the name of my character in the upcoming series will be Abu Obaida.”

Earlier, Israeli media launched a violent attack on Egyptian star Mohamed Ramadan, after he called on Egyptians and Arabs to join the fight and defend the Gaza Strip.

Last week, Ramadan called on the Arab armies to use their weapons to defend Gaza, saying in a video he posted on his social media accounts: “I have received many requests to publish something so that our voice can be heard ... Our voice must be heard by our country.”

Abu Obeida is the military spokesperson for Hamas' al-Qassam Brigades.
